Output 4633c8a8288ac883a94f189732dc7f766198f2237d017ccd4609f5875a7a80f8:5

value
13420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584f1c554582f5214e61e7f9e21eced8200332fa OP_EQUAL
address
39jxA8Yr15mvR6EZaMnH6ENMPoXaHAhMpd
transaction
4633c8a8288ac883a94f189732dc7f766198f2237d017ccd4609f5875a7a80f8
spent
true